Assistant Coach Reports to: The athletic director, who provides overall objectives and final evaluation in conjunction with the principal. Job Goal
To instruct athletes in the fundamental skills, strategy, and physical training necessary for them to realize a degree of individual and team success. At the same time, the coach must instruct and demonstrate behaviors that lead to socially acceptable character development, self discipline, self confidence, and pride of accomplishment in the student athletes. General
The success of athletic programs has a strong influence on the community's image of the entire system. The public exposure is a considerable responsibility and community/parent pressure for winning performance is taxing, but must not override the objectives of good sportsmanship and good mental health. The position includes other unusual aspects such as extended time, risk of injury factor and due process predicaments. It is the express intent of this job description to give sufficient guidance to function. In cases not specifically covered, it shall be assumed that a coach shall exercise common sense and good judgment. Duties and Responsibilities
Has a thorough knowledge of all the athletic policies approved by the Chapel Hill-Carrboro City Schools' Board of Education and is responsible for their implementation. Understands the proper administrative line of command and refers all requests or grievances through proper channels. Student Responsibilities
Serves as a mentor to each athlete to promote the development and demonstration in student athletes the character traits of trustworthiness, respect, responsibility, fairness, caring, and citizenship.
